Australia Bans Reservoir Dogs Before Launch

The Australian Personal Computer Magazine (APC) is reporting that the country’s government has banned the upcoming release of Eidos’ Reservoir Dogs for the PC, PlayStation 2 and Xbox. “Atari, the Australian distributor of EIDOS’ major upcoming release, has had the title scrapped after being refused classification by the Office of Film and Literature Classification (OFLC). … Read more

Grand Theft Auto Scrutinized by New York

Take-Two Interactive today announced that on June 19, 2006, the company received grand jury subpoenas issued by the District Attorney of the County of New York requesting production of documents, covering various periods beginning on October 1, 2001, including those relating to: the knowledge of the company’s officers and directors regarding the creation, inclusion and … Read more
